После запуска python repl (2.7.10) в терминале os-x и выхода из него терминал больше не выводит ввод с клавиатуры, и происходят некоторые другие странные вещи. Если я снова запускаю python
и выполняю exit()
, то терминал, похоже, восстановлен. Теперь я просто закрываю вкладку и открываю новую, так что я не проверял это подробно.
Я думаю, это связано с настройками терминала, но это недавняя вещь, и я ничего не изменил, что я помню. Python устанавливается вместе с macports
, если есть какое-то отношение к несовпадающим зависимостям с какой-либо консольной библиотекой. 2.7.10 была установлена некоторое время назад, а после установки этого не произошло.
Трещит костяшки и открывает terminal
[~]: virtualenv-2.7 venv-test
[~]: source venv-test/bin/activate
[~]: python
>>> ^D>>> *(press ctrl-d, the 2nd >>> is strange)
[~]: *(type something like `ls-l`, nothing shows on console)
[~]: -bash: ls-l: command not found`
Кроме того, повторный запуск python и нажатие ctrl-d
приводит к следующим выводам:
>>> ^D (ctrl-d, then hit enter, doesn't exit)
>>> ^D (...)
>>> ^D (...)
>>> exit() (typing exit() quits the session)
>>> [~]: